Residential Rodent Exclusion in Minneapolis, MN

Residential Rodent Exclusion

Mechanical perimeter defense stopping Mus musculus (house mouse) and Rattus norvegicus (Norway rat) migrations into domestic living quarters. Technicians identify sub-quarter-inch entry penetrations along limestone and poured foundations, sealing perimeter gaps with 300-series stainless steel mesh, heavy-gauge galvanized hardware cloth, and moisture-cured elastomeric sealants. Strategic interior trapping protocols rapidly extract nesting populations from utility chases and basement drop ceilings without scattering rodenticides into pet-accessible living areas. Standard diagnostics and localized sealings begin at $150 to $350, securing structural envelopes against winter thermal invasions.

Carpenter Ant Colony Elimination in Minneapolis, MN

Carpenter Ant Colony Elimination

Biologically directed eradication focused on Camponotus pennsylvanicus nesting inside water-damaged wall studs, subfloors, and window framing. Service protocols bypass surface broadcast sprays to deliver non-repellent transfer chemistry directly into satellite and parent gallery networks. By targeting interior foraging trails and treating external perimeter moisture zones, worker ants transport active micro-doses into the primary queen chamber. Field inspections evaluate roof leak zones, plumbing penetrations, and wood-to-ground contacts to systematically correct the conditions driving wood destruction, typically priced between $225 and $495 depending on gallery dispersion.

Thermal Bed Bug Remediation in Minneapolis, MN

Thermal Bed Bug Remediation

Definitive multi-stage thermal and targeted chemical remediation for Cimex lectularius infestations in residential sleeping spaces. Technicians conduct clinical inspections of mattress seams, box springs, headboards, baseboards, and electrical outlets to map harborage clusters. Treatment uses high-output electric convective heaters to elevate room temperatures to the lethal thermal threshold of 122°F to 135°F for sustained intervals, destroying adult insects, nymphs, and eggs in a single targeted evolution. Targeted residual desiccant dusts are installed inside wall voids to provide ongoing perimeter protection, with single-room and multi-room treatments starting from $375 to $950.

Cockroach Integrated Sanitation and Eradication in Minneapolis, MN

Cockroach Integrated Sanitation and Eradication

Comprehensive population extraction targeting Blattella germanica (German cockroach) clusters in kitchens, multi-family pipe chases, and food-handling zones. Technicians employ high-efficiency particulate air (HEPA) vacuum extraction to mechanically reduce adult harborage points on contact, clearing active nesting areas behind motor housings and cabinetry. Technicians then apply insect growth regulators (IGRs) combined with rotation-specific bait matrices within unexposed structural seams, disrupting biological reproductive cycles while keeping domestic living surfaces chemically neutral. Initial extraction and bait placement protocols range between $175 and $385.

Subterranean Termite Soil Barrier Treatments in Minneapolis, MN

Subterranean Termite Soil Barrier Treatments

Targeted subterranean defense protocols defending structural support beams and sill plates against Reticulitermes flavipes colonies. Field crews trench and treat foundation margins with non-repellent termiticides, forming a continuous barrier zone that foraging termites pass through undetected. The carrier chemical is transported across the underground colony matrix via grooming and food sharing, arresting chitin synthesis and neutralizing the reproductive core without internal drilling where possible. Comprehensive liquid soil barriers and exterior perimeter monitoring systems run between $550 and $1,450.

Seasonal Perimeter Insect Barrier in Minneapolis, MN

Seasonal Perimeter Insect Barrier

Systematic exterior barrier applications timed to spring thaw and late-summer aggregations of pavement ants, boxelder bugs, and nuisance spiders. Treatment applies microencapsulated non-staining perimeter suspensions 3 feet up the exterior masonry wall and 5 feet outward along the soil line, targeting weep holes, basement window wells, and sill gaskets. This prevents exterior foraging insects from crossing foundation cold-joints or penetrating lower-level window casements during high-humidity seasons, establishing uninterrupted perimeter protection at $150 to $240 per seasonal application.

Buyer's guide

Choosing the right pest control services pro in Minneapolis

Selecting the right pest intervention protocol depends directly on the specific pest taxonomy, infestation maturity, and the age of the structure's building envelope. If property owners observe frass shavings or hollow-sounding framework along rim joists during warm months, choosing targeted carpenter ant structural injections eliminates satellite colonies nesting within damp lumber; if the issue involves nighttime rustling, droppings along baseboards, or shredded attic insulation, selecting physical perimeter rodent exclusion mechanically blocks mice from entering foundation expansion joints. The fundamental operational trade-off centers on perimeter surface repellent sprays versus comprehensive physical exclusion: surface barrier sprays offer immediate knockdown of exterior foraging pests at an initial service minimum of $150, but fail to prevent interior migrations once seasonal temperatures plummet below zero; full mechanical exclusion requires structural labor and sealing materials ranging between $250 and $650, yet permanently eliminates recurring entry access without maintaining perpetual indoor pesticide footprints.

When addressing multi-unit residential layouts or older basements with fieldstone foundations, choosing full-structure Integrated Pest Management (IPM) targets the biological microclimate, moisture levels, and entry vectors simultaneously rather than displacing the colony into adjacent living quarters.

Properties throughout Minneapolis face distinct seasonal biological stresses due to older housing foundations, high water tables, and severe temperature fluctuations. Historic homes in neighborhoods like Whittier, Northeast Minneapolis, and Linden Hills frequently feature fieldstone, soft brick, or mortar-seamed basements that settle, leaving 1/4-inch to 1/2-inch gaps near sill plates. When temperatures drop below zero across Hennepin County, field mice and Norway rats naturally follow basement thermal vents inward. Concurrently, proximity to the Mississippi River Gorge and the Chain of Lakes drives summer moisture directly into structural framing, accelerating wet-wood rot that attracts carpenter ants.

Does physical rodent exclusion work better than chemical poison baiting?
Physical exclusion provides a permanent mechanical barrier, whereas chemical baiting alone allows exterior rodents to continually enter before dying inside interior wall cavities. Sealing foundation gaps, sill plate seams, and utility entry points with galvanized mesh and industrial sealants stops access completely. Interior mechanical traps then quickly remove existing mice without leaving decaying carcasses behind drywall to cause severe odors and fly issues.
How frequently should a Minneapolis home receive seasonal perimeter treatments?
Minneapolis residential properties benefit from two to three targeted perimeter services annually to match regional pest biology. A spring treatment applied in April or May neutralizes emerging carpenter ants and foraging pavement ants as soil thaws. An early autumn exterior treatment delivered in September or October forms a barrier against boxelder bugs and prevents rodents from seeking indoor thermal vents before the first hard Hennepin County freeze.
